An affordable, ADEK-licensed school in Al Shamkha following an English-medium British curriculum, sitting at the budget end of Abu Dhabi's private market.

Fees run roughly AED 18,000 to AED 27,500 from KG to Grade 12, and the school enrols around 2,000 students across pre-K to Year 13. ADEK currently rates performance Acceptable, which is the regulator's middle tier. Families who choose ABC tend to be local residents of Al Shamkha and the South Shamkha communities rather than the embassy-circuit crowd.

Teachers earn warm word-of-mouth from primary parents, who describe staff as attentive and approachable. The most consistent gripe is on the admin side, with reports of brusque service at the registration office. As a low-fee British-stream option in this part of Abu Dhabi, it competes mainly with similar tier schools like Al Yasmina branches and other Shamkha-area academies rather than the Saadiyat or Reem premium set.

  • The 2022-23 ADEK inspection round rated ABC Private School Good, with 65% of measures scored Good and improvements logged in primary and secondary student achievement.
  • Inspectors described partnerships with parents and the community as Good, with one parent survey leaning slightly negative across 11 respondents, with most still recommending the school. Sample size is small.
  • Inspectors flagged a gap between strong internal assessments and weaker GL standardised test performance, plus inconsistent challenge for high-achieving students and weak PIRLS 2021 reading results.
  • Governance was rated Acceptable, declining from the previous round, and inspectors noted limited parent involvement in strategic school planning.
  • Parents quoted in inspection notes describe staff as approachable, supportive and responsive, with strong day-to-day communication.
